The Healthy Eating with APP TechnologY Study

The aim of this study is to investigate the effect of using new app-based technology to improve dietary habits, compared to usual care in patients with type 2 diabetes. The hypothesis is that the intervention, i.e. using the new technology an an app-based course for healthy eating habits, will have a greater positive effect on dietary habits and biological markers, including HbA1c and serum lipids, than usual care.

Inclusion criteria

  • Have a diagnosis of type 2 diabetes
  • 18 years of age or older
  • Ability to communicate in Swedish
  • Own and use a smartphone with a personal digital ID

Exclusion criteria

  • No specific exclusion criteria apply

Treatment and study plan

App-technology for healthy eating habits

Behavioral

Access to smartphone-app, including a 12 week healthy eating program. A new theme on healthy dietary habits is presented each week.

Other outcomes

  1. Change in dietary intake and eating habits

    Time frame: Baseline and month 3, 6 and 12

    Assessed using a 94 item food frequency questionnaire (FFQ)

  2. Change in eating behaviour assessed using Three-Factor Eating Questionnaire-R21 (TFEQ-R21)

    Time frame: Baseline and month 3, 6 and 12

    Assessed using a 21-item questionnaire

  3. Change in physical activity assessed using the Active-Q questionnaire

    Time frame: Baseline and month 3, 6 and 12

    Assessed using a 48 item questionnaire including activities in domains of Daily occupation, transportation, leisure time, and exercise

  4. Change in self-reported medication use

    Time frame: Baseline and month 3, 6 and 12

    One question on medication use for blood sugar levels and one questions on medication use for blood lipid levels

  5. Change in tobacco use habits

    Time frame: Baseline and month 3, 6 and 12

    Two questions regarding smoking and Swedish snuff use

  6. Change in sleeping habits

    Time frame: Baseline and month 3, 6 and 12

    Assessed using a modified 13-item Karolinska Sleep questionnaire

  7. Change in perceived purpose in Life (PIL)

    Time frame: Baseline and month 3, 6 and 12

    Assessed using 6-item questionnaire

  8. Change in perceived stress levels

    Time frame: Baseline and month 3, 6 and 12

    Assessed using the 14-item perceived stress scale (PSS)

  9. Change in self-reported diabetes self-efficacy

    Time frame: Baseline and month 3, 6 and 12

    Assessed using a 20-item questionnaire

  10. Change in health related quality of life

    Time frame: Baseline and month 3, 6 and 12

    Assessed using the 36-item RAND-36 questionnaire

  11. Change in perceived social support from family and friends for healthy eating habits

    Time frame: Baseline and month 3, 6 and 12

    Assessed using a 3-item questionnaire
